“Captain in Love”
Astra Filmworks is seeking talent for a vertical miniseries that will be released on the app Sereal+. Two actors, aged 21–38, are wanted for the lead roles of Jane and Lorenzo. Partial nudity will be required for both roles; an intimacy coordinator will be available on set. Filming will take place between Dec. 10–20 in Los Angeles. Pay is $500 per day for nine days of work.

Financial Brand - Customer Stories Videos
Blue Chalk Media is seeking models in Tampa, Florida; Portland, Oregon; and New York City, aged 18–55, for non-speaking roles in a finance brand commercial. Talent will work between Jan. 16 and 30, depending on the work location. Pay is $1,800 for two days of work.

Language Learning Commercial
A language-learning company is seeking talent for a short digital ad spot. Seattle, Washington-based actors, aged 20–65, are wanted for the shoot, which will take place on Dec. 2. Pay is $800–$1,800.

“Never Again”
Join the cast of “Never Again,” an indie feature film about a young woman recovering from childhood abuse who must escape a serial killer. A white female actor, age 29–40, is wanted for the supporting role of Jillian, the protagonist’s sister. Filming will begin on April 25, 2025, in Kansas City, Missouri. Pay is $6,600 for 12 days of work with on-set food and gas/mileage allowance provided.
